Actions

Extract Structured Data

Extract Structured Data

Extract structured data from one or more web pages using your extraction prompt. Returns results in JSON and supports options like CAPTCHA solving and stealth browsing.

Crawl Website

Crawl Website

Crawls a website and returns structured page data.

Extract Web Content

Extract Web Content

Extract readable content, links, HTML or screenshots from a web page URL. Options allow including/excluding selectors, extracting only the main content, and enabling CAPTCHA solving or stealth browsing.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I start an integration between Hyperbrowser and quip?

To start, connect both your Hyperbrowser and quip accounts to viaSocket. Once connected, you can set up a workflow where an event in Hyperbrowser triggers actions in quip (or vice versa).

Can we customize how data from Hyperbrowser is recorded in quip?

Absolutely. You can customize how Hyperbrowser data is recorded in quip. This includes choosing which data fields go into which fields of quip, setting up custom formats, and filtering out unwanted information.

How often does the data sync between Hyperbrowser and quip?

The data sync between Hyperbrowser and quip typically happens in real-time through instant triggers. And a maximum of 15 minutes in case of a scheduled trigger.

Can I filter or transform data before sending it from Hyperbrowser to quip?

Yes, viaSocket allows you to add custom logic or use built-in filters to modify data according to your needs.

Is it possible to add conditions to the integration between Hyperbrowser and quip?

Yes, you can set conditional logic to control the flow of data between Hyperbrowser and quip. For instance, you can specify that data should only be sent if certain conditions are met, or you can create if/else statements to manage different outcomes.

About quip

Quip is a modern productivity suite that enables you and your team to collaborate on any device. It works across iPhone, iPad, Android phones and tablets, and the desktop web. Quip has a simple and elegant interface that combines documents and messages into a single chat-like “thread” of updates, making collaboration immediate and easy. You can share documents, tables, checklists, and more so multiple people can edit and discuss together in a single, shared workspace.
